Abbott BinaxNOW Test Cards Available from VDH

VHCA-VCAL has heard from several members that orders for antigen testing supplies has become challenging over the past few weeks. We reached out to VDH and were advised that the agency has Abbott BinaxNOW rapid antigen test cards available for nursing home and assisted living facility providers.
 
Facilities interested in receiving these can submit requests using the following link: https://forms.gle/TfL93Wnd51zzB2Ho7.
 
Please note that the VDH supply has an expiration date of December 19, 2021, so submit your orders as soon as possible to use the available supply. VDH will not accept requests after December 1, 2021.
HRSA Extends PRF Application Window and
Provides Phase 4 and Rural CHOW Guidance

On October 25, the Health Resources & Services Administration (HRSA) announced that providers have additional time to complete their Provider Relief Fund Phase 4 and Rural Application. The new FAQ states:
 
  • All applicants must complete the first step of the application process (i.e., submitting their Taxpayer Identification Number (TIN) and associated information for Internal Revenue Service (IRS) validation) no later than October 26, 2021, at 11:59 pm EST. 
  • The required IRS validation that occurs after completion of the first step may take a few days. 
  • If an applicant submits their TIN for validation by the October 26, 2021 deadline and that TIN is subsequently validated by the IRS, the applicant will have until November 3, 2021 at 11:59 pm EST to complete and submit their application.
 
Additionally, last week, HRSA provided AHCA/NCAL with guidance on changes of ownership. Based upon the guidance, between the seller and the buyer, the eligible applicant depends on:

  • The filing TIN that is associated with the application. 
  • If the “seller” no longer has a filing TIN, they would not be eligible. 
  • If the “buyer” has a new filing TIN and the sale has been approved by CMS by the date the organization initiates its Phase 4 application, the buyer is the entity eligible to apply. 
 
Providers may contact HRSA’s Provider Support Line for assistance with challenging issues, such as TIN validation, at (866) 569-3522.
